Ir al contenido principal

Recuperar clave de root (GRUB)

Si en algún momento llegas a perder la clave de root de tu equipo linux y estas usando GRUB como gestor de arranque solo tienes que seguir estos pasos para entrar al sistema en modo de usuario único.

  1. Cuando te aparezca el menú del grub, debes situarte sobre la opción de arranque que desees utilizar y presionar 'e', con esto entras en una nueva pantalla donde te aparecen varias lineas del shell.
  2. En la linea del Kernel presiona 'e' nuevamente y agrega al final de la misma init=/bin/bash (sales del modo edición con la tecla "ESC"
  3. presiona 'b' para que el sistema arranque nuevamente
  4. Una vez en el sistema, debes remontar la partición / (o cualquier otra donde este tu archivo passwd), puesto que seguramente se monto como solo lectura, para esto ejecuta: mount -o remunt, rw / (si no te funciona con "/", prueba con "/dev/hda1" ó la partición correcta para tu instalación)
  5. Una vez que remontes la partición ya solo te queda cambiar la clave con passwd y reiniciar el equipo

Comentarios

Entradas más populares de este blog

Instalar Icinga2 en debian Wheezy con BD Postgres

A continuación les dejo una guía rápida para la instalación de Icinga2  en debian wheezy,  cuando tenga que hacerlo en jessie actualizo el manual. Lo primero que debes tener en cuenta es que en la pagina de Icinga tienes bastante documentación sobre como hacer esto mismo, de hecho este manual esta basado en lo que allí aparece. Otro detalle es que parto de la idea que ya tienes configurado Apache2 y Postgres Comencemos por agregar los repositorios necesarios. Debian Monitoring Project ~# echo "deb http://debmon.org/debmon debmon-wheezy main" > /etc/apt/sources.list.d/wheezy-debmon.list ~# wget -O - http://debmon.org/debmon/repo.key 2>/dev/null | apt-key add - OK Según lo referido en esta pagina es posible que existan problemas de dependencias con icinga2 así que es recomendable agregar también el repositorio backports Debian Backports ~# echo "deb http://http.debian.net/debian wheezy-backports main" > /etc/apt/sources.list.d/wheezy-bac...

Recuperar GRUB 2 EFI utilzando rEFInd

Recientemente tuve un problema con un laptop dual-boot (widows/linux) al actualizar el Windosw 8.1 a 10.  En una de las tantas reiniciadas de windows me quede sin el gestor de arranque grub, por lo que les explico como hice para recuperarlo, finalizar la actualización y dejar intacto mi querido debian. Se que se puede recuperar el grub con una distro live y seguir algunos pasos, pero como comente la actualización a windows 10 aun no terminaba así que no quería tener que hacer esto a cada rato por lo que me decidí a probar rEFInd . Lo primero es decidir que imagen utilizar, yo tenia a disposición un viejo USB de 512M así que baje la imagen A USB flash drive image file (les recomiendo revisar la web por si existe una nueva versión) Una vez descargado el archivo podemos copiarlo al USB, para lo que utilizaremos el comando dd. Esto borrara toda la información que tenían en el mismo . root@lenovoG480 #~ dd if=refind-flashdrive-0.9.0.img of=/dev/sdg1 13696+0 regi...

Migrar cuentas entre servidores de correo usando pop2imap

A continuación les dejo una forma sencilla de migrar cuentas de correo entre 2 servidores de correo utilizando para ello un script en perl creado por LinuxFrance pop2imap  el cual posee entre sus ventajas: transferencias incrementales (solo descarga los mensajes que no estén en el servidor de destino) y que el mismo puede ser ejecutado desde un equipo distinto a los servidores de origen y destino. La gente de LinuxFrance también tiene otro script llamado  imapsync  que funciona de manera similar pero para IMAP. Yo estoy usando debian 7 así que las dependencia a instalar para mi distro son estas: aptitude install libmail-pop3client-perl libmail-imapclient-perl libdigest-hmac-perl libemail-simple-perl libdate-manip-perl Una vez que tenemos instaladas las dependencia podemos extraer y ejecutar el script, para ello basta con ejecutar: tar -xzvf pop2imap-1.18.tgz Con lo cual se descomprime el archivo en la carpeta pop2imap-1.18...